Golf Tops

While there’s more flexibility with this specific item, compared to men’s golf tops, as women can wear both collared and non-collared shirts, it’s essential to check in first with the specifics of what’s required at the golf course you intend to visit; some may still require the collared, as opposed to others. Either way, you’ve got many cool designs to pick from, including polos with zippers.
When the temperatures are on the rise, you can also choose from the sleeveless designs – these make for cute and practical outfits so you look your best and stay comfortable on the course. Now, when the weather is getting colder, you can warm up easily by layering up with golf ladies’ clothing like cardigans, vests, sweaters, jackets and wind shirts. In some cases, it’s also possible to wear a hoodie, but still to be on the safe side, ensure the golf course allows it, and pick out one that enables your arms a full range of motion for utmost comfort and convenience.
Golf Bottoms
Don’t think you’re limited when it comes to the bottoms either – there are various trendy models of pants, skirts, shorts and skorts to choose from depending on what you prefer and the weather conditions of that day. When it comes to comfort and functionality, many immediately have leggings in mind for the snug fit they provide.
Are leggings proper golf attire? This is a valid question because they’ve been seen in the world of golf as of late. Still, while some places allow them, and they’re becoming increasingly acceptable for the game, they’re not common in country clubs and formal tournaments where the tradition of the game is valued. They’re more of post-game relaxation items in this aspect, much like the sweatpants.
Before splurging on them, be sure to check in with the course you plan on playing at, and in case they’re not allowed, you can always resort to the next best thing: slim leg ankle pants. In terms of skirts, shorts and skorts, it’s advisable to pick from a specialised golf women’s apparel store to have peace of mind regarding appropriate length. As far as the options go, you’re truly spoiled for choice with the variety of models and colour choices.

Golf Shoes
As the support and foundation for your game, you can’t forget to consider the appropriate shoes too. Same as with the specific women’s golf clothes, there are adequate shoes made for golf to provide you with the needed comfort and functionality so you can make the most of your time on the greens. There’s a reason why you can’t just show up in your favourite pair of sneakers or sandals – the golf footwear is made to offer you the needed traction so you get the stability required for optimal performance.

Golf Don’ts
As already established, this is a game of tradition and your look is part of the game too. When we speak of don’ts, it’s important to mention some items and styles are a big no-no, especially jeans, cargo pockets on pants and shorts, short skirts, skorts, and shirts that expose cleavage. While we’re at shirts too, avoid baggy designs since other than not looking polished, they can interfere with your swings.
